Design Consultant
Join the TileBar Team!
TileBar is excited to announce the opening of our new Raleigh Showroom, and we're looking for an enthusiastic and service-driven Showroom Design Consultant to join our growing team.
In this role, you'll be the face of our showroom, working directly with a diverse clientele—including homeowners, designers, contractors, and installers—to provide personalized service, expert design advice, and a best-in-class customer experience.
We offer a competitive compensation package, including a strong base salary, commission incentives, and opportunities for career growth within a fast-expanding brand.
What You'll Do
* Customer Engagement: Be the primary point of contact, offering expert advice, resolving inquiries, and ensuring a seamless showroom experience.
* Design & Consultation: Curate materials, recommend products, and create custom design boards that reflect client needs and style.
* Product Knowledge: Stay up to date on TileBar's offerings, brand values, and industry trends to provide the best solutions.
* Sales & Order Management: Oversee the full sales cycle—from quoting and purchase orders to order fulfillment and CRM tracking.
* Customer Experience & Team Collaboration: Partner with colleagues to ensure smooth operations, timely deliveries, and a positive customer journey.
* Relationship Building: Cultivate long-term client relationships to foster loyalty and repeat business.
* Brand Ambassador: Represent TileBar with professionalism and passion, upholding our values and commitment to service.
What We're Looking For
* Education & Experience:
+ High School Diploma required; Bachelor's preferred.
+ 3-5 years of sales or customer service experience (showroom, retail, or luxury sales a plus).
+ Experience in tile, stone, furniture, textiles, or building materials is highly desirable.
* Sales & Customer Focus:
+ Proven ability to achieve and exceed sales goals through consultative selling.
+ Strong relationship-building and customer-first mindset.
+ Excellent communication and presentation skills.
* Industry & Product Knowledge:
+ Familiarity with tile, stone, or flooring products preferred (or a passion to learn).
+ Ability to educate clients on design solutions and project planning.
* Technical & Operational Skills:
+ Pro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ite; CRM experience (SalesPad, Magento, Salesforce, etc.) is a plus.
+ Strong math, problem-solving, and order management skills.
+ Understanding of logistics and supply chain processes.
* Personal Attributes:
+ Strong time management and multitasking skills in a fast-paced environment.
+ Collaborative, proactive, and solution-oriented mindset.
+ Flexibility to work retail hours, weekends, evenings, and events as needed.
